泛型編程 泛型是一種參數(shù)化類型的機(jī)制(類型占位符),為算法和類型的實(shí)現(xiàn)提供了更高的復(fù)用性缤苫、更強(qiáng)的安全型吵血、更好的性能。 泛型支持包括:函數(shù)秒紧、類燕少、結(jié)...
結(jié)構(gòu)與枚舉 結(jié)構(gòu) struct屬于值類型鞍陨,具有值拷貝語(yǔ)義(賦值與傳值)struct不支持面向?qū)ο笫凭觯饕糜诙x輕量級(jí)數(shù)值類型阻塑;class支持面向...
1.Swift簡(jiǎn)介 Swift是在Objective-C的基礎(chǔ)上,借鑒了很多現(xiàn)代高級(jí)語(yǔ)言果复,發(fā)展而成的一門(mén)安全陈莽、高效、支持多種編程規(guī)范式的編程語(yǔ)言...
數(shù)據(jù)存儲(chǔ)--簡(jiǎn)易數(shù)據(jù)存儲(chǔ) 數(shù)據(jù)持久化 1.本地:文件 NSHomeDirectory() / Documents虽抄;數(shù)據(jù)庫(kù)2.云端:iCloud...
多線程--NSThread main thread主線程 在一個(gè)運(yùn)行的iOS應(yīng)用中走搁,處理UIKit對(duì)象的所有方法調(diào)用。程序啟動(dòng)后迈窟,系統(tǒng)自動(dòng)創(chuàng)建主...
動(dòng)畫(huà) UIKit 動(dòng)畫(huà)用于交互設(shè)計(jì):更好的展示:relationship私植,structure,cause & effect UIView提供的動(dòng)...
工程管理 從源碼到App Workspace管理一組Project,這些項(xiàng)目將使用同一個(gè)位置:保存項(xiàng)目狀態(tài)车酣;保存構(gòu)造出來(lái)的產(chǎn)品曲稼;自動(dòng)可以互相引用...
界面布局 - View 的定位 UIView 表示屏幕上一塊矩形區(qū)域索绪;負(fù)責(zé)提供相應(yīng)區(qū)域的現(xiàn)實(shí)內(nèi)容,也處理相應(yīng)區(qū)域的事件響應(yīng)躯肌。 iOS界面由一個(gè)樹(shù)...
TableView 1.表視圖組成及相關(guān)概念 1.表頭視圖(table header view)者春。表視圖最上邊的視圖破衔,用于展示表視圖的信息清女。2....